Technical Specifications

Material Special Brass (CU Zn 40 Pb2)
Press Sleeve Stainless Steel
Reduction 20 x 2 - 16 x 2
Certification DVGW, UBA-Positivliste
Operating Pressure 10 bar
Temperature Range Up to 95°C

Product Features and Benefits

  • Safe for Drinking Water: Fully approved for drinking water installations (DVGW DW-8501BS5049), ensuring your water stays clean.
  • UBA Compliant: Meets the UBA positive list standards, providing you with extra assurance.
  • High Load Capacity: Durable under continuous loads of 10 bar at 70°C for over 50 years, giving you a long-lasting, reliable connection.
  • Maximum Operating Temperature: Can withstand temperatures up to 95°C, making it suitable for high-temperature demands.
  • Unpressed Leakage: Designed to leak when unpressed, helping you identify errors early.
  • Modern Contour: Optimized flow with a free passage minimizes flow noise, so you enjoy a quieter and more efficient system.
  • Optimal ZETA Values: Features the largest passage area for maximum inner diameter, ensuring optimal flow rates for your system.
  • Low-Lead or Lead-Free: All components are DVGW-certified and compliant with drinking water regulations, protecting your health.
  • Versatile Use: One fitting system works for both multi-layer composite and copper pipes (DVGW-certified), offering you installation flexibility.
  • Secure Pressing: A guide ring prevents the pipe from being pushed out before pressing, guaranteeing a precise and seamless connection for maximum safety.
  • Double Safety: Dual O-rings, combined with seamless pressing, prevent oxygen from entering the system.
  • Quality Material: Made from special brass (CU Zn 40 Pb2) with a stainless steel press sleeve for durability.
  • Integrated Control: Includes an integrated inspection window in the stainless steel sleeve to verify insertion depth for added safety.
  • Multi-Contour Compatibility: Fully compatible with TH- and U-press jaws up to dimension 32 x 3.0 mm.

How to Use (Step-by-Step)

  1. Step 1: Prepare the Pipe: Cut the pipe to the required length using a suitable tool. See Figure 1.
  2. Step 2: Calibrate and Deburr: After cutting, calibrate and deburr the pipe end with a calibrator.
  3. Step 3: Insert: Then, insert the pipe into the fitting until it stops. The correct insertion depth can be verified through the three inspection windows on the stainless steel press sleeve.
  4. Step 4: Press: Press using a suitable pressing tool and a press jaw that matches the fitting dimensions.
